CryoEM structure of the membrane pore complex of Pneumolysin at 4.5A
Summary for 5LY6
Entry DOI | 10.2210/pdb5ly6/pdb |
EMDB information | 4118 |
Descriptor | Pneumolysin (1 entity in total) |
Functional Keywords | bacterial toxins, pore complex, cryoem structure, cholesterol-dependent cytolysin, pneumolysin, membrane pore, toxin |
Biological source | Streptococcus pneumoniae serotype 2 (strain D39 / NCTC 7466) |
Total number of polymer chains | 1 |
Total formula weight | 52866.07 |
Authors | van Pee, K.,Neuhaus, A.,D'Imprima, E.,Mills, D.J.,Kuehlbrandt, W.,Yildiz, O. (deposition date: 2016-09-24, release date: 2017-04-05, Last modification date: 2024-05-15) |
Primary citation | van Pee, K.,Neuhaus, A.,D'Imprima, E.,Mills, D.J.,Kuhlbrandt, W.,Yildiz, O. CryoEM structures of membrane pore and prepore complex reveal cytolytic mechanism of Pneumolysin. Elife, 6:-, 2017 Cited by PubMed: 28323617DOI: 10.7554/eLife.23644 PDB entries with the same primary citation |
Experimental method | ELECTRON MICROSCOPY (4.5 Å) |
